Meaning & Definition
In text messaging, “ATM” most commonly stands for “At The Moment.” It is used to describe something happening right now or in the current situation.
For example:
- “I’m busy ATM” → I am busy at the moment
- “Can’t talk ATM” → I cannot talk right now
It serves as a time-related expression, helping people communicate quickly without typing full sentences. This abbreviation is widely used because it saves time and keeps conversations casual and efficient.
Outside texting, “ATM” can also stand for:
- Automated Teller Machine (banking)
- Atmosphere (unit of pressure in science)
The meaning depends entirely on context, which is why understanding usage is important.
Background
The use of abbreviations like “ATM” grew with the rise of SMS texting in the early 2000s. At that time, messages had character limits, encouraging users to shorten words and phrases. Over time, these abbreviations became part of everyday digital language.
With the growth of social media platforms and instant messaging apps, short forms like “ATM” gained even more popularity. People prefer quick communication, especially on mobile devices, where typing speed matters.
Interestingly, “ATM” originally had a strong association with banking systems. However, as internet culture evolved, the meaning “At The Moment” became dominant in informal communication. Today, both meanings coexist, and users rely on context to understand the intended use.

Meaning in Physics, Medical, and Aircraft Terminology
Physics
In science, “ATM” stands for atmosphere, a unit used to measure pressure.
- 1 ATM = standard atmospheric pressure at sea level
Medical Field
In medicine, “ATM” may refer to specific technical abbreviations depending on context, though it is less commonly used compared to other terms.
Aviation (Aircraft)
In aviation, “ATM” can stand for Air Traffic Management, which involves controlling and managing aircraft movement safely and efficiently.
These meanings are formal and completely different from texting usage.

Differences from Similar Words
“ATM” differs from similar expressions in tone and usage:
- ATM vs RN: Both mean “right now,” but “ATM” is slightly more descriptive
- ATM vs Currently: “Currently” is more formal
- ATM vs Now: “Now” is direct, while “ATM” feels conversational
Choosing the right term depends on the tone of communication.
